About The Artwork

I have a thing for picking up odd lifelike pieces at flea markets, antique stores etc. I have this little wooden cracked egg with legs that I just adore because even though it has no face, it say so much. Every single one of us can identify with this egg because we all have cracks! We all feel like our legs are there but we havent finished hatching to our full potential at some point in our lives. This little guy gave me the inspiration to make this beautiful piece. I called it "Self Portrait" because I have cracks and flaws, I feel like im the queen of my world but still feel like I havent completely come out of my shell yet. This piece is made with acrylic paint on a 30x40 canvas. It has been Gloss Varnished and strung for hanging.

Welcome to Wonderland Toledo!! Toledo born, Award Winning Artist Shannon Eis is best known for her work in found object sculpture that she calls JUNKEEZ and her work in Epoxy Resin. In her resin pieces you will often find a large array of different stones ranging from quartz crystals and obsidan to natural rubies and emeralds. She also includes glass, glitters, shells, bones and found objects. While Shannon is constantly creating with different mediums, she also teaches Resin art, acrylics, jewelry making, Polymer clay dollmaking and alcohol ink landscapes in many different venues. This multi-talent artist also co-owns Wonderland Studio and Gallery in downtown Toledo, Ohio. With numerous national and local awards under her belt, her ultimate goal is to have an encased hot dog bun on the wall of Tony Packo's restaurant. Shannon has created many custom works including a custom Jeep Wrangler Grille for the Toledo Mayors office. She also has her work on public display for 3-5years at the corner of 11th and Jefferson in Toledo via a vinyl wrap awarded by The Arts Commission. Shannon also teaches epoxy resin, alcohol inks, polymer clay dolls, acrylic painting and pouring, as well as bead weaving, amongst other things. Shannons creative mind is an inspiration to others.
